You're now logged in to your macOS desktop. ![]() Connect to the remote session of the macOS instance as ec2-user using the password that you set in step 3. As mentioned, the hidden Screen Sharing app is a complete VNC client, and though itâs not necessarily the most full featured app in the world it is more than adequate for connecting to and controlling any remote machine running a VNC server, whether thatâs another Mac with. Note: If you experience authentication errors with RealVNCSet, then set Encryption to Prefer On or Prefer Off until one of those settings works.Ħ. This is an alternative to using the the Connect to Server keyboard shortcut or the Safari launch approach. VNC Server: localhost:5900 Encryption: Let VNC Server Choose Select OK. Select New Connection from the File drop-down menu. ![]() Then, enter the following in the Server Address field: vnc://localhost:5900įor Windows: Using the RealVNC Viewer client, connect to the macOS host over the SSH Local Port Forwarding tunnel. Other clients, such as TightVNC running on Windows, don't work with this resolution.įor macOS: To access the VNC viewer, open Finder, select Go, and then select Connect to Server. ![]() For Windows, you can use RealVNC Viewer for Windows. This is a release of VNC Viewer for Windows, Mac and Linux computers you want to exercise control from. Using a VNC client, connect to localhost:5900. In the following command, replace keypair_file with your SSH key path, and replace 192.0.2.0 with your instance's IP address or DNS name: ssh -i keypair_file -L 5900:localhost:5900 Keep the SSH session running while you're in the remote session.Ä¥. Run the following command to set a password for ec2-user: sudo /usr/bin/dscl. Sudo launchctl load -w /System/Library/LaunchDaemons/Ä£. Run the following command to install and start VNC (macOS screen sharing SSH) from the macOS instance: sudo defaults write /var/db/launchd.db//ist -dict Disabled -bool false It's a best practice to avoid opening VNC ports in your security groups.Ä¢. For security reasons, traffic to the VNC server is tunneled using SSH. Or, you can establish a connection using AWS VPN or AWS Direct Connect that allows you to access your instance through a private IP. In this case, use a bastion or jump server to connect to the instance. Note: You can make the instance accessible through a public IP address or an Elastic IP address while it's in a public subnet. The VNC client (or viewer) is the program that represents the screen data originating from the server, receives updates from it, and presumably controls it by. If you're using an older version of Windows, then use Git Bash to implement the preceding command. Or, you can activate the OpenSSH client by selecting Settings, Apps, Apps & features, Manage optional features, Add a feature, and then select OpenSSH Client. % ssh -i keypair_file 10 and newer versions of Windows Server have an OpenSSH client installed by default. Replace keypair_file with your key pair and Instance-Public-IP with the public IP of your instance. Use the following command to use SSH to connected into your EC2 macOS instance as ec2-user. Connect to your EC2 macOS instance using SSH. There are a number of reasons why your local mouse pointer on the VNC Viewer may not be calibrated with the remote hosts pointer. To launch Virtual Mode sessions, you will instead need to run the command, vncserver-virtual.Note: The following steps are tested for macOS Mojave 10.14.6 and macOS Catalina 10.15.7.Ä¡.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|